The Connecticut Lottery today held the state's fourth Super Draw raffle drawing, creating one new millionaire and several winners of other cash prizes.

A complete list of winning numbers for the drawing can be found at Lottery Post's Connecticut Lottery Results page.

The game has a total of 1,311 cash prizes, ranging from $100 to a top prize of $1 million cash.

Raffle tickets went on sale April 1, 2012, and cost $10 each.  Each ticket sold contains a unique six-digit number from 100001 to 375000.  Nearly all of 275,000 tickets were sold out prior to the drawing.

$100 prizes can be paid at any Lottery retail location, and $1,000 prizes may be claimed at any Connecticut Lottery High-Tier Claim Center.  $20,000 and $1 million prizes must be claimed at Connecticut Lottery Headquarters.

Winners have 180 days from July 4, 2012 to claim their prize.

Connecticut's first $1,000,000 Super Draw raffle drawing was held Jan. 1, 2011.  The state has used the same prize structure and ticket price and quantity in each of the subsequent three Super Draw raffle drawings, including today's drawing.
